Trip Overview

Fuquay-Varina to Asheville is 248.8 miles and takes about 4h 57m via I 40, US 64, and Isaac Brooks Highway, with a fuel budget near $38 and enough daylight to finish in a day. This trip stays within North Carolina, moving from the Southeast region towards the mountains. With over 80% of the route on highways, expect a relatively straightforward drive. About the Cities

Starting in Fuquay-Varina, NC

Full guide →

Founded 1909

Fuquay-Varina is a city of about 33,000 people (as of 2020) in North Carolina. Originally the two separate communities of Fuquay Springs and Varina, which merged upon incorporation in 1909. The town is often referred to simply as "Fuquay", pronounced ['fyu-kwei] (FYOO-kway).

Arriving in Asheville, NC

Full guide →

Founded 1797

The city of Asheville is a liberal, artsy community nestled between the Blue Ridge Mountains and Great Smoky Mountains in Western North Carolina. A popular tourist destination, this "Paris of the South," has one of the most impressive, comprehensive collections of Art Deco architecture in the United States. In 2011 Asheville was picked as one of the “10 Most Beautiful Places in America” by Good Morning America.
